CPU Trading:

CPU trading is allowed to a degree, but it is in no way allowed in a sweeping fashion. NO "Stars" from teams will be traded, period. I.E. the 49ers are open, you aren't getting Kaepernickle.

"Star" status is officially determined by Rox, if he considers the player on the team you want a star the above regulation applies and you start looking for a new opportunity.

All CPU trades must be posted in the Trade Centre for review. Review can take a number of days and possibly a full advance cycle, so be patient while waiting for judgement.



User Trading:

All User+User trades must be posted in the Trade Centre for review similarly to the CPU trades. Review can take a number of days and possibly a full advance cycle, so be patient while waiting for judgement.

Both parties must accept a trade for the trade to be considered "officially". The person who posts the thread automatically "agrees", but the other party in the deal must now post something to the effect of: "I agree", "Sure", etc.
Posting the thread or the comment in reply is the only way to get your trade eventually approved or denied.

Once the trade has been approved you will have until the end of the next league week to complete the trade; If you fail to do so your team will be fined a random starter being benched in addition to whatever players involved in the deal being relegated to special teams status.



Remember that for a trade to be completed both teams must either have played their game or not played their game for the week. Easier visualized like this:

Therefore if you and your partner are trying to get your trade in, either do it before you play your games or do it after you both have played. Otherwise madden will auto-deny the trade when you try to accept. If you and your trade partner find yourselves in this situation, send the trade and accept it when the other guy has played their game.

Other reasons for trades not going through on madden include:

  • One team doesn't have the roster space.
              - Release players until you can fit all the players in the trade.
  • One team doesn't have the required salary cap space.
              - Release players until you can fit all the players under the cap. Make sure you free up money, check salaries first!
              - This also includes if you trade for picks and get a high pick the rookie reserve will take a chunk out of your cap.
